Why the Stock Market Rallies Into Year End

Why the Stock Market Rallies Into Year End

The S&P 500 came into October this year up double digits. It has done so on 42 occasions since 1926. That’s almost 50% of the time. Of those 42 times, in 35 cases the market went up through the end of the year. That’s an 85% success rate, about as…
